Output 5def18aea605cc592dcf0620e848ef43c6217af4739c815550fcfe64dccfe5b1:1

value
28602246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d63e0f13996f4e5680cac28810f398978b51ad OP_EQUAL
address
3Nv9LsZWMVNrz5aPGQRDkL6w7vENoJCJ1v
transaction
5def18aea605cc592dcf0620e848ef43c6217af4739c815550fcfe64dccfe5b1
confirmations
372795
spent
true